I made every kind of fruit smoothie, and ate every kind of ice cream. Oh mama. But then I needed to healthify my craving, so I turned to these coconut water fruit slushies.
They each only have two ingredients: frozen fruit + coconut water. You can absolutely add a bit of agave to sweeten them up. I found that the strawberry and banana versions didn't need to be sweetened, but the blueberry version could use a bump of sweetness.
You can use frozen fruit right from the bag, or slice and freeze your own.
You can layer them together for even more fun!
